Citikey Free Business Directory Register Free Add

Indoor Markets in Northfield, Birmingham

Northfield Market
Bristol Road South, Northfield, Birmingham B31 2PA
InShops is a chain of indoor markets which house a variety of stalls ranging fro…
Add business | Terms | Privacy | Contact
© Citikey Directories 2025 All Rights Reserved